Drawings and zones

Upload and calibrate drawings, then draw the zones that structure inspection coverage and package assignment. Each zone-and-stage pairing becomes a record in its own right, carrying its dates, status, sign-off and witness.

Giving a record a place

  1. 01

    Calibrate

    Upload the floor plan and calibrate it so positions on the drawing are positions in the building.

  2. 02

    Zone

    Draw zones over the plan — the same zones drive the inspection matrix for every package.

  3. 03

    Pin

    Raise an NCR or a snag against the plan or the IFC model, pinned where it was found.

  4. 04

    Find

    Scan the QR anchor in the corridor and see the records for that location, standing in it.
